Science, tech fuel artist’s varied and vivid ouevre

Radiometer chandelier.

(Credit:
Luke Jerram)

Yes, artist Luke Jerram‘s most widely known piece may perhaps be “Play Me, I’m Yours” — an artwork that temporarily distributes actual full-size pianos on the streets of major cities for anyone to play. After all, it’s been featured in hugely populated towns like New York City and Los Angeles. But his body of work displays a particular fascination with science and technology.

One sculpture, for instance, is based on the seismogram generated by the 2011 Japan earthquake. Others draw from data visualization as well: charts of the ups and downs of the Dow Jones Industrial Average and the New York Stock Exchange. Microbiology, optics, and the history of sound recording have also inspired compelling pieces.

iPad mini to debut during second half of 2012?

The iPad and its imaginary, smaller friend.

(Credit:
CNET)

Apple has reportedly already tagged LCD suppliers for an iPad mini, with an eye toward launching the tablet in the second half of the year.

This latest scuttlebut comes courtesy of Taiwan news outlet Liberty Times (English translation).

Citing the usual, vague “market rumors” but also a report from Japanese securities firm Macquarie, the Liberty Times said the iPad mini could start shipping by the end of the third quarter with a goal of 6 million units.

That 6 million is the same number projected last month by Chinese online portal Netease.

Here’s what Android fragmentation really looks like

Samsung's Galaxy S II is the most prevalent Android device, trailed by almost 4,000 others.

(Credit:
Screenshot by Eric Mack / CNET )

Open Signal Maps is a nifty free Android app and Web site that crowdsources where the strongest and weakest cell signals are. But along the way, it’s also managed to amass a ton of data about what kind of Android devices are out there in the wild and they pulled it all together into some visualizations that dramatically show the extent of Android fragmentation.

OSM started logging the Android devices that download the app six months ago and created the above visualization — the interactive version on the site is a little more informative — from a sample size of 681,900 devices. What it reveals is that Samsung’s Galaxy series, particularly the Galaxy S II, is far and away the top dog, followed distantly by the HTC Desire series. After that, it turns into quite a mess of devices ranging from other heavy hitters like Motorola’s Droids down to the Hungarian Concorde Tab, which showed up once.

Intertech 20 Year Anniversary Open House


Saint Paul, MN (PRWEB) May 10, 2012

Intertech (http://www.Intertech.com) is celebrating its 20 year anniversary, record 2011, and new building with an Open House on May 31, 2012. The Open House will feature presentations on Groovy, WinRT, and leadership. Attendees for the presentation can attend in-person at Intertech or live via webinar. Everyone is welcome to attend the event but registration via Intertech’s website is required.

“Our 20 year anniversary wouldn’t be possible without our customers or employees. I thank them both,” stated Intertech Founder and CEO, Tom Salonek.

The open house starts at 2:00 CST and finishes at 6:00. There will be three presentations during the open house. Session one will be an Intro to Groovy. Session two will be an overview of WinRT, Metro Style Apps, and Windows 8. Session three will be on building a winning business. Additional information on the sessions and presenters can be found in this release.

Session 1: An Introduction to Groovy

Among the many alternate Java Virtual Machine (JVM) programming languages, Groovy is quite popular. It is just over 5 years old, yet eWeek reported in Sept 2011 that it was the fastest growing programming language. In this talk, well teach you how to get a Groovy environment setup and give you a quick tour of some its features. Prerequisites for this talk: basic Java.

What You Learn: How to get, setup and use Groovy:


Groovy language basics
Cool Groovy features for Java developers
Why use Groovy over Java or other alternate JVM languages
Warnings associated with using Groovy

Intertech delivers training and consulting on Groovy and related technologies including Java training.

Session 2: An Overview of Windows 8, Metro Styles Apps and WinRT

The Windows 8 OS will present an entirely new UI which is markedly different from that of Windows 7. In this talk, you will be given a tour of the of the Windows 8 UI and come to learn the role of a Metro Style App.

More importantly, this talk will provide an overview of the new runtime environment (WinRT) and programming model.

About Intertech

Founded in 1991, Intertech, Inc. has grown from a one-person shop to the largest combined software developer training company and research-supported consulting firm in Minnesota. Intertech designs and develops software solutions that power Fortune 500 businesses along with teaching these and other organizations including mid-sized companies and state government.

Intertech works with NASA, Wells Fargo, Lockheed Martin, Microsoft, Intel, and other major companies around the United States helping them learn and use technology.
